I applied through an employee referral. The process took 4 weeks. I interviewed at ASML in Mar 2022
Interview
In total my interview process consisted in 4 rounds:
1) Interview with recruiter to gauge fit with role.
2) Interview with RTE & Team Lead.
3) Interview with PO & other Scrum Master.
--> After this interview I was asked to do an assessment which looked at my intelligence, personality and fit with ASML values.
4) Interview with HR to discuss results test.
After this an offer was made to me.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
Situational questions: How would you handle situation X? (e.g. resistance against scrum within team).
Experience questions: How does your experience relate to what you will do at ASML?
Personality questions: Depending on outcome of assessment.
